WebCilostazol comes as a tablet to take by mouth. It is usually taken twice a day, at least 30 minutes before or 2 hours after breakfast and dinner. Take cilostazol at around the same times every day. Follow the directions on the prescription label carefully, and ask your doctor or pharmacist to explain any part you do not understand. WebTake cilostazol on an empty stomach 1 hour before or 2 hours after a meal unless otherwise directed by your doctor. Food may reduce the absorption of cilostazol. Taking cilostazol on an empty stomach will make it easier for your body to absorb the … Cilostazol Interactions. Food increases absorption; approximately 90% increase in peak plasma concentration and 25% increase in AUC when administered with a high-fat meal.

WebApr 1, 2024 · For oral dosage form (tablets): For treatment of peripheral vascular disease (circulation problems): Adults—100 milligrams (mg) two times a day, taken at least 30 minutes before or 2 hours after breakfast and dinner. Your doctor may adjust your dose as needed. Children—Use and dose must be determined by a doctor. WebApr 16, 2024 · Cilostazol is known to affect multiple cells including platelets, vascular smooth muscle cells, adipose cells, and ventricular myocytes. As such, it has a wide spectrum of biomolecular effects, including platelet inhibition, vasodilation, anti-proliferation, and attenuation of ischemic-reperfusion injury, among others [1, 4,5,6].Such pleiotropic …

WebJun 15, 2024 · Cilostazol is used to treat intermittent claudication. This is a cramping pain that develops in the lower leg when you walk and is due to poor circulation. Vasodilators like cilostazol increase the distance you can walk before the pain develops. Cilostazol works in two ways.
